Our Peace Lies In Listening To God And Following His Commands

Jonah 3:1-10
Luke 10:38-42

In today’s first reading, after Jonah was given a second chance, God called him and this time around, he obeys the commands of God to go to Nineveh and preach repentance to them saying , ‘Only forty days more, and Nineveh will be destroyed Jonah 3:4. When he thundered at the notoriously sinful population of Nineveh, they were awoken from their evil behavior and repented, putting on sackcloth and ashes. So far from God had the Ninevites strayed that they faced terrible disaster, but at the last moment they realized that they must leave their sins behind. They heard and heeded the warning. They repented of their sins from greatest to the least person and God spare them of the punishment that they were suppose to receive. In summary , the book of Jonah is a proof of God’’s inexhaustible mercy not only for Jonah or the Israelites but also for the impious heathen city of Nineveh. It shows that God, is the ruler of all nations and He has given these people repentance for life. For Israel or the Jews, respectively, this was very difficult to understand for they considered only themselves as God’s elect people (Matthew 12:41; Matthew 16:4; Luke 11:29-32; Acts 10; Acts 11).

In today’s gospel passage, we see our merciful Lord visiting his friends in their home and they saw him great hospitality. In this scenario, we see the preoccupation, restlessness and anxiety of Martha as against Mary her sister who listened to Jesus at his feet and gave him undivided attention. The lesson for Martha, Mary and all of us is that we should welcome Jesus into our home but essentially into our hearts. We must balance our spirituality starting from intensive interior life of prayer to the work of apostolate. ‘That is, Be contemplative indoor and apostles outdoor’.

As Jonah received a second chance, this is your chance to step on stage for REPENTANCE IS NOW . Let us learn to depend on God’s word and not on ourselves or the sign that we see or we are expecting.
